Chaos in Solving Polynomial Systems for Computational Kinematics by Newton-Raphson Method

摘要 Problems in mechanism analysis and synthesis and robotics lead naturally to systems of nonlinear equations. In this paper, an approach based on Newton Raphson method and the property of fractals is presented to obtaining all roots of equation.
